Assessing Your Home's Solar Prospective
Before diving right into solar panel installment, you ought to analyze your home's solar possibility. Start by inspecting your roofing system's positioning and incline; south-facing roofing systems typically catch the most sunlight.
Seek any kind of obstructions, like trees or high buildings, that might cast darkness on your panels. These can considerably decrease energy production. Consider your neighborhood environment as well; sunny areas generate far better outcomes than continually gloomy areas.
Next, evaluate your energy demands and usage patterns to figure out the amount of panels you'll require. You may also want to utilize on the internet solar calculators or talk to a specialist to get a clearer picture.

Panel Performance Scores
As you check out the globe of solar panels, comprehending panel performance scores is critical for making an informed decision. These rankings show just how efficiently a panel transforms sunshine into functional electricity. The higher the effectiveness, the extra power you'll create from a smaller sized room. The majority of residential panels range from 15% to 22% efficiency.
When picking your panels, consider your energy requirements and offered roofing room. If you have actually restricted space, going with higher-efficiency panels could be advantageous. Nonetheless, if you have adequate roofing location, lower-efficiency panels could suffice.
Installment Type Alternatives
Choosing the best setup kind for solar panels can dramatically impact your system's efficiency and effectiveness. You'll typically run into 2 main choices: roof-mounted and ground-mounted systems.
Roof-mounted panels are typically the go-to option for house owners, as they utilize existing room and can be cheaper to set up. Nevertheless, if your roof covering isn't appropriate-- probably due to shielding or structural issues-- ground-mounted systems might be the better option.
They permit optimum positioning, optimizing sunlight exposure. Furthermore, you can change their angle to improve efficiency.
Prior to deciding, take into consideration aspects like readily available space, budget, and local guidelines. By reviewing these options very carefully, you'll ensure your solar panel installation meets your power requires successfully.
Visual Considerations
While capability is critical, looks shouldn't be ignored when selecting solar panels for your home. You desire panels that not only work properly yet likewise complement your home's style.
Consider the shade and dimension of the solar panels; black panels often mix effortlessly with dark roofs, while blue panels could stick out extra. Check into options like building-integrated photovoltaics (BIPV) that change traditional roof covering products, providing a sleek appearance.
You might additionally explore solar tiles, which mimic standard roof covering and can improve aesthetic appeal. Do not fail to remember to examine the format and placement of the panels to maximize both efficiency and visual consistency.
Inevitably, striking the ideal equilibrium in between performance and looks will certainly make your solar financial investment much more gratifying.
